New Delhi: All that glitters is gold; this very belief is marked by the Hindu festival of Dhanteras. It is celebrated two days prior to Diwali. It is an auspicious occasion to purchase precious metals like gold and silver.
The markets may have crashed and stocks may have fallen but that isn’t stopping people from going on a shopping spree.
And with the gold prices having come down from Rs14000 to 12000 within a fortnight, this Dhanteras certainly promises to bring lots of shine to the jewellers’ business as well.
"The gold prices have come down and Dhanteras is considered auspicious so expecting a good movement,” says vice-president Gold Souk Ashish Gupta.
This has led to a shopping spree across the country and the trend seems to have delighted both the shoppers and the retailers equally. The jewellers as well as the consumer durable retailers now hope that this might set the mood for a good Diwali.
